Jon Lord, claviériste de Deep Purple, est mort

Jon Lord – Jonathan Douglas “Jon” Lord aka ‘Hammond Lord’ – co-fondateur et claviériste du groupe de rock britannique Deep Purple est décédé lundi 16 juillet 2012 à la London Clinic d’une embolie pulmonaire à l’âge de 71 ans. Le musicien luttait contre un cancer du pancréas depuis le mois d’août dernier. Né en 1941 …

An analysis of The Handmaid’s Tale by Margaret Atwood

Introduction Margaret Atwood is a Canadian writer born in 1931, who studied literature in Toronto. In the 1960s, she was a graduate specialist in Harvard and then came back to Canada to teach literature. She was a well-known poet with The Edible Woman (1969), Surfacing (1972), Life before man (1979), The Robber Bride (1993). Margaret …
